The University of Nebraska Factor
Lincoln's anchor institution, the University of Nebraska-Lincoln, enrolls over 25,000 students annually, creating an insatiable demand for rental housing. This educational powerhouse serves as an economic engine that makes Lincoln one of the best rental markets in Nebraska. Student housing investments near campus consistently deliver cash flow yields of 8-12%, significantly outperforming traditional residential investments.
Beyond student housing, the university attracts faculty, researchers, and support staff who require longer-term rental accommodations. This diverse tenant mix reduces vacancy risk and provides multiple exit strategies for investors, from buy-and-hold to student housing conversion opportunities.

The "Lifestyle" Pick: Growth in Grand Island
When considering the best places to invest in real estate Nebraska has to offer, Grand Island stands out as the perfect "lifestyle pick" for investors seeking a balance between growth potential and quality of life. This central Nebraska gem has quietly emerged as one of the fastest growing cities in Nebraska, offering real estate investors a unique opportunity to capitalize on sustainable growth while enjoying the benefits of small-town charm and big-city amenities.
Why Grand Island Ranks Among Up and Coming Real Estate Markets Nebraska
Grand Island's strategic location at the intersection of Interstate 80 and US Highway 281 positions it as a crucial hub for commerce and transportation throughout the Midwest. This geographic advantage has attracted major employers including JBS USA, Chief Industries, and Case New Holland, creating a stable employment base that drives consistent housing demand. For investors evaluating up and coming real estate markets Nebraska offers, Grand Island presents compelling fundamentals that mirror the success seen in larger markets like Omaha.
The city's population has grown steadily over the past decade, reaching approximately 53,000 residents, with demographic trends indicating continued expansion through 2026. Young professionals and families are increasingly drawn to Grand Island's affordable cost of living, excellent schools, and outdoor recreational opportunities, making it an attractive alternative to more expensive metropolitan areas.
Investment Opportunities and Market Dynamics
Real estate investors will find Grand Island offers exceptional value propositions compared to markets like Lincoln or Omaha. While investors often ask "is Lincoln a good place to invest?" or focus on Omaha NE real estate investment opportunities, Grand Island provides similar growth potential at significantly lower entry points. Median home prices remain well below state averages, yet rental demand continues strengthening across all property types.
The local rental market demonstrates particularly strong fundamentals, positioning Grand Island among the best rental markets in Nebraska. Single-family homes consistently achieve occupancy rates above 95%, while multi-family properties command competitive rents with minimal vacancy periods. This stability stems from the diverse economic base and steady population growth that characterizes the city's development pattern.

Kearney: The Central Nebraska Gem
Positioned strategically in central Nebraska, Kearney has quietly evolved into one of the fastest growing cities in Nebraska, making it an exceptional opportunity for forward-thinking investors. Home to the University of Nebraska at Kearney, this college town offers a stable foundation of rental demand that rivals even established markets like Lincoln and Omaha.
The city's economic diversification extends far beyond its educational roots. Major employers including Baldwin Filters, Eaton Corporation, and the regional medical center have created a robust job market that supports sustained housing demand. According to the Nebraska housing market forecast 2026, Kearney is projected to experience 15-18% population growth over the next three years, driven primarily by its expanding healthcare sector and manufacturing base.
What makes Kearney particularly attractive for investors is its affordability compared to larger metropolitan areas. The median home price remains approximately 30% below state averages, while rental yields consistently outperform many traditional investment markets. The presence of over 7,000 university students creates year-round demand for rental properties, positioning Kearney among the best rental markets in Nebraska.
Infrastructure improvements, including the recent completion of Highway 30 expansions and enhanced broadband connectivity, have positioned Kearney as a regional hub for commerce and technology. These developments are attracting young professionals and families, creating diverse tenant pools that reduce investment risk.

Investment Strategies for Both Markets
Both Kearney and Papillion offer unique advantages for different investment strategies. In Kearney, multi-family properties near the university campus provide excellent cash flow opportunities, while single-family homes in established neighborhoods appeal to faculty and healthcare professionals.
Papillion's market favors single-family rental properties and townhomes that attract commuters working in Omaha but preferring suburban living. The area's proximity to Offutt Air Force Base also creates steady demand from military families seeking quality housing options.
